Sunroof wind noise
Hi everyone -
Wind noise comes from the back of the sunroof beginning at 40 mph. I don't get any leaks from rain or carwashes, and the external seals look good. I drive the car with the shade closed so I don't have to listen to it.
Any ideas?

But, referring to car wash leak or rain leak, one may not know how much liquid is getting past the closed sunroof as the sunroof has a gutter system and drain tubes that pour out from the car any liquid that may come in (as long as the tubes are not stopped-up), so one may not know whether water is coming in from such sources.
